In-State vs Out-of-State Tuition
Yeshiva Gedola Tiferes Yerachmiel is listed as Private nonprofit in the local dataset. In-state tuition is $9,400 and out-of-state tuition is $9,400. The reported in-state and out-of-state tuition values match in this dataset.
International Student and Private College Tuition Note
The local database lists Yeshiva Gedola Tiferes Yerachmiel as Private nonprofit. Private colleges commonly report one tuition rate rather than separate resident and nonresident rates. In this dataset, Yeshiva Gedola Tiferes Yerachmiel reports $9,400 for out-of-state tuition and $9,400 for in-state tuition. International student billing, visa expenses, health insurance and aid eligibility should be verified directly with the school.

Average Net Price After Aid
Based on available data, the average student at Yeshiva Gedola Tiferes Yerachmiel pays approximately $7,820 per year after grants and aid. This is below the New Jersey average of $17,613 and below the national average of $17,506.

Financial Aid and Scholarships
About 43.26% of Yeshiva Gedola Tiferes Yerachmiel students receive federal Pell grants, indicating the share of students receiving this need-based aid in the local dataset. 0.00% take federal loans, which helps families understand borrowing patterns alongside net price.

Accreditation
Yeshiva Gedola Tiferes Yerachmiel lists Association of Institutions of Jewish Studies as its accreditor in the local dataset. Institutional accreditation is an important trust signal and can affect federal financial aid eligibility. Accreditation means an external agency has reviewed academic quality and institutional standards, which helps families verify whether federal aid pathways such as Pell grants and federal loans may apply.
Campus Location and Contact
Yeshiva Gedola Tiferes Yerachmiel is listed at 911 Somerset Avenue, Lakewood, NJ 08701-0000. Accreditor: Association of Institutions of Jewish Studies.
